Prospect Theory (also called Perspective Theory) is a concept of cognitive psychology that is related to decision making in economic and financial contexts.
According to this theory, people, in general, tend to make choices based on potential losses rather than gains. In other words, the basis of the Prospectus Theory is the tendency that we all have to harbor a certain risk aversion.

Brian is trying to remember the colors of the visible spectrum: red, orange, yellow, green, blue, indigo, and violet. Brian decides to use the acronym ROYGBIV, which contains the first letter of each of the colors' names. Brian is using <u>a mnemonic</u> to remember the colors. A nmemonic is any structured pattern or idea which could be visual or verbal that helps individuals to easy remember things. This patterns include the use of acronyms, rhymes, peg-word methods and even chunking.
